雾霾下行人轨迹预测新模型,融合物理先验与图状交互建模。
Hazy Pedestrian Trajectory Prediction via Physical Priors and Graph-Mamba
- 用可微分大气散射模型分离雾霾浓度与光照衰减,学习去雾特征。
- 自适应Mamba提升78%推理速度,同时保持长程依赖建模能力。
- 图注意力网络捕捉行人与群体多粒度互动,适合复杂场景智能系统。
为解决雾霾天气下行人轨迹预测中物理信息退化与交互建模无效的问题,本文提出一种结合大气散射物理先验与行人关系拓扑建模的深度学习模型。首先,构建可微分大气散射模型,通过网络估计物理参数,解耦雾霾浓度与光照退化,实现去雾特征表示学习。其次,设计自适应扫描状态空间模型用于特征提取,其变体相比原生Mamba推理速度提升78%,同时保留长程依赖建模能力。最后,开发异构图注意力网络,利用图矩阵建模行人与群体间的多粒度交互,并结合时空融合模块捕捉行人运动的协同演化模式。此外,基于ETH/UCY构建新数据集评估方法有效性。实验表明,在能见度低于30米的浓雾场景下,该方法相较最先进模型,minADE与minFDE指标分别降低37.2%和41.5%,为恶劣环境下智能交通系统的可靠感知提供了新范式。

To address the issues of physical information degradation and ineffective pedestrian interaction modeling in pedestrian trajectory prediction under hazy weather conditions, we propose a deep learning model that combines physical priors of atmospheric scattering with topological modeling of pedestrian relationships. Specifically, we first construct a differentiable atmospheric scattering model that decouples haze concentration from light degradation through a network with physical parameter estimation, enabling the learning of haze-mitigated feature representations. Second, we design an adaptive scanning state space model for feature extraction. Our adaptive Mamba variant achieves a 78% inference speed increase over native Mamba while preserving long-range dependency modeling. Finally, to efficiently model pedestrian relationships, we develop a heterogeneous graph attention network, using graph matrices to model multi-granularity interactions between pedestrians and groups, combined with a spatio-temporal fusion module to capture the collaborative evolution patterns of pedestrian movements. Furthermore, we constructed a new pedestrian trajectory prediction dataset based on ETH/UCY to evaluate the effectiveness of the proposed method. Experiments show that our method reduces the minADE / minFDE metrics by 37.2% and 41.5%, respectively, compared to the SOTA models in dense haze scenarios (visibility < 30m), providing a new modeling paradigm for reliable perception in intelligent transportation systems in adverse environments.
